As speculated yesterday, Final Fantasy X-2 is conjuring its collection of enchanted clothing onto the PlayStation 3 and Vita. The latest issue of Japanese publication Jump magazine has confirmed that the title will ship alongside its predecessor Final Fantasy X on a single Blu-ray named Final Fantasy X|X-2 HD Remaster for the PS3. Sadly, handheld gamers will be forced to purchase each title separately.
The re-mastered RPGs will be based upon the International Edition iterations of the previous generation games. Siliconera has a scan of the Jump magazine article through here, which includes a couple of comparison screenshots from the hotly anticipated overhaul. We suspect that we’ll be seeing a lot more in the coming weeks.
